Deposition of Gold Clusters on Porous Coordination Polymers by Solid Grinding and Their Catalytic Activity in Aerobic Oxidation of Alcohols
Chemistry - A European Journal · 2008 · Vol. 14(28) · pp. 8456–8460
Tamao Ishida✉(Tokyo Metropolitan University)Megumi Hamano Nagaoka(Tokyo Metropolitan University)Tomoki Akita(Japan Science and Technology Agency)Masatake Haruta(Tokyo Metropolitan University)
Abstract
Gold clusters were deposited in a narrow size distribution on porous coordination polymers (PCPs) by solid grinding with volatile dimethyl AuIII acetylactonate. The mean diameter could be minimized down to 1.5 nm for Al-containing PCP. Gold clusters on PCPs showed noticeably high catalytic activity in the aerobic oxidation of alcohols. Product selectivity was tunable by the selection of PCP supports in benzyl alcohol oxidation.
